Description:
Phe-D-met-arg-phe amide, also known by its CAS number 84313-43-9, is a synthetic peptide that exhibits characteristics typical of peptide compounds. It is composed of a sequence of amino acids, specifically phenylalanine (Phe), D-methionine (D-met), arginine (Arg), and another phenylalanine (Phe), with an amide functional group at the terminal end. This structure contributes to its potential biological activity, particularly in the context of receptor binding and signaling pathways. Peptides like this one often demonstrate specific interactions with biological targets, which can include hormones, neurotransmitters, or other signaling molecules. The presence of D-amino acids, such as D-methionine, can enhance stability against enzymatic degradation, making such peptides of interest in therapeutic applications. Additionally, the hydrophobic nature of phenylalanine may influence the peptide's solubility and interaction with lipid membranes. Overall, the characteristics of Phe-D-met-arg-phe amide suggest its relevance in pharmacological research and potential therapeutic uses.
